I think people need to learn, beforehand, to empathize more with victims of hurricanes. Helene is looking to be catastrophic and news reporting is going to frame a lot of victims as responsible for their own suffering.
People who do not evacuate, people who leave pets behind, people who try to drive through floodwaters, people who will go to the stores in the wake of the storm and will “loot” are all going to be demonized and blamed. Be framed as burdens to rescue efforts.
It should be understood that these people aren’t just being stubborn or cocky or greedy. Or don’t love their pets enough. Often, these are people who have no choice.
Not everyone has somewhere to go to. Hotels get booked up fast and often have no pets policies. Traffic to evacuate is horrific and slow. Gas, lodging, fresh groceries because you have to leave all your food behind may not be affordable for the people who “choose” to stay behind. Maybe they don’t have a car or enough space to fit their entire household.
Many people’s jobs will not let them have the time off to leave until the very last minute and they cannot afford to lose their jobs.
Many people have medical devices that cannot be easily transported and they can’t leave behind.
There are many reasons to shelter in place.
And when the government abandons them or takes their precious time helping them out, they will be hungry and desperate. And deserve the food and supplies left behind. It is not looting when lives are on the line.
And even if they had all the means to evacuate, all the time in the world and no traffic in their way… they do not deserve to die, lose everything, or face prosecution or shaming for what they have to do to survive. Hubris is not a punishable offense.
We need to counter these harmful narratives now. And never let the victims of natural disasters be blamed, especially not with climate change making things worse and the most vulnerable people being seen as acceptable losses to it.

I've been contacted multiple times now for a scam on this site which is...
If someone contacts You, asking you to buy a commission (with listed reasons too like rent or food)... you need to watch out. All scams are shitty, but this one especially is taking advantage of an inclination to trust people and want to help :/ you should always, of course, verify where your money is going before you send it
Multiple times after posting with the word 'commission' in it, I've had accounts reach out asking if I'm buying any. Once the post in question was me being excited i had a commission in progress— definitely not a rime im likely to be buying another, but the scammer was likely just searching for any use of the word and messaging en masse
The accounts have art on them, but all reblogged or posted in a short time frame, fairly recent, and only a page or two total. This art is stolen, usually from very small artists, making it harder to backtrace. Talking to the person will be quite rushed towards reaching a payment. But there isn't necessarily one obvious script here
I'm just saying.... generally, artists don't reach out from the blue to ask you to commission them. People can work in various styles, but check someone's page. Reverse image search if there's any hackles raised. Legitimate people do have new accounts or no professional profile, and may need money desperately... but there are 100% scammers out there too.
It feels extremely shitty to accuse someone of being a scammer, but if you don't feel you can trust them, you can ALWAYS politely decline and refuse further conversation. "I'm not looking to commission right now, but thank you".
(In slightly similar scam watch, my ancientass never used Fictionpress has been overflowing with a similar but more obvious version of this— someone going "I love your writing!! I'm an artist and would love to make art for your story?". I've received like 10 variations of this script now. They're either wanting money full stop, or hoping to get you to pay for AI slop.)

I have a problem with the idea of a Jinx redemption arc. It's not that I have any issue with the fact that Jinx will be viewed as a hero to the people of Zaun. It's pretty obvious Jinx would be admired, she did a thing the people of Zaun wanted en masse for a long time. The thing about Jinx being the savior of Zaun is that it isn't really a redemption arc, because that's still just Jinx being militantly opposed to Piltover, a thing she always has been.
My problem is that the insistence that Jinx NEEDS to have a redemption arc takes away from the larger complexity of Arcane's worldbuilding. What does Jinx have to apologize for in order to be redeemed? Why is there so much emphasis on Jinx's character specifically to rectify her wrongs? And the way the fandom often defines Jinx's wrongdoings centers around a vague discomfort in her acts of violence and general instability.
What does it look like for Jinx to be "good", when the actions of many well-intentioned characters that the audience has an easier time being morally-aligned with either generates very little benefit or actual harm? No one in the cast sans Jinx and Silco have taken the material steps (as controversial as they may be) to deal with the problem that is Piltover, and Piltover has always been THE problem for Zaun.
The concept of a redemption arc for Jinx is so backwards because it asks Jinx as an individual to do "better" when it should be demanded of Piltover instead. How do you live to a standard that makes you morally good when the environment around you necessitates violence as it's own form of capital?
Sidenote: This all leads to the one real worry I have about Jinx and Ekko's inevitable partnership. Ekko is the character the showrunners treat as a guiding light in Zaun, which unfortunately makes Ekko an agent of the showrunners' biases. Case in point, Ekko's friendship with Heimerdinger, the architect of Zaun's despair.
If Jinx and Ekko team up, there's a chance she'd up end up working with Heimerdinger too. And it's like, "C'mon, really????"
